Job Overview: A law firm seeks an experienced Immigration Attorney for a full-time, on-site position in Manassas, VA. The successful candidate will handle a range of immigration matters, including visas, legal issues related to immigration, and other day-to-day legal tasks. This role requires a thorough understanding of immigration law, strong analytical skills, and the ability to communicate effectively with clients. The Immigration Attorney will work independently and as part of a team to deliver effective legal counsel and solutions for clients navigating complex immigration processes.

Duties:

  • Provide legal advice and counsel to clients on various immigration matters, including visa applications, green cards, naturalization, asylum, and deportation defense.
  • Handle complex immigration law issues, including family-based and employment-based immigration cases.
  • Conduct legal research on immigration laws, policies, and procedures to provide accurate and up-to-date advice.
  • Prepare and file immigration petitions, applications, and other necessary legal documents with the relevant authorities.
  • Represent clients in immigration hearings and proceedings before government agencies.
  • Assist clients with legal challenges related to their immigration status and provide tailored solutions.
  • Collaborate with other attorneys and support staff to ensure smooth case management and successful outcomes.
  • Maintained accurate case files and documentation, ensuring all client matters were handled in compliance with applicable laws and regulations.

Requirements:

  • Juris Doctor (JD) degree from an accredited law school.
  • Active membership with the Virginia State Bar.
  • Proven experience handling immigration matters, including visas, deportation defense, and family-based or employment-based immigration.
  • Strong legal research and analytical skills.
  • Ability to communicate clearly and effectively, both in writing and verbally.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a collaborative team.
  • Fluency in a second language is preferred but not required.
